What can I use instead of baking powder in biscuits?

If you find yourself lacking baking powder in your pantry while trying to whip up a batch of biscuits, don’t fret! There are a few substitutes you can use instead. One option is to replace the missing baking powder with an equal amount of baking soda, but you’ll also need to add an acidic ingredient like vinegar, lemon juice, or buttermilk to activate the baking soda. Another alternative is to use cream of tartar and cornstarch in place of baking powder. For every teaspoon of baking powder, you can use a combination of 1/2 teaspoon of cream of tartar and 1/4 teaspoon of cornstarch. This substitute will result in a slightly denser biscuit compared to those made with baking powder, but it will still turn out delicious! Lastly, you can try using yeast as a substitute, but this will require a longer rising time and will yield a more bread-like result. Whichever substitute you choose, be sure to adjust the recipe accordingly to ensure the right consistency and texture for your biscuits.

What keeps biscuits from rising?

When it comes to baking biscuits, rising is crucial for achieving the desired texture and fluffiness. However, sometimes biscuits fail to rise, leaving them dense and heavy. There are several reasons that can prevent biscuits from rising, including:

1. Overworking the dough: When too much flour is added or the dough is overworked, it can lead to the development of gluten, which can restrict the biscuits’ ability to expand. To prevent this, it’s essential to handle the dough gently and avoid overmixing the ingredients.

2. Using too much baking powder: While baking powder is necessary for biscuits to rise, adding too much can cause them to collapse. It’s essential to follow the recipe’s instructions and not exceed the suggested amount.

3. The dough is too warm: Biscuits require a cold dough to rise properly. If the dough is too warm, the butter can melt, leading to a dense texture. To avoid this, it’s recommended to keep the dough cold by using ice-cold butter and handling the dough as little as possible.

4. Not using enough baking powder: If not enough baking powder is added, the biscuits won’t have enough lift to rise. It’s crucial to follow the recipe’s instructions and not omit or reduce the amount of baking powder.

What happens if I use baking soda instead of baking powder?

When baking powder is called for in a recipe and baking soda is inadvertently used instead, the result can be a dense and heavy baked good. Baking soda is a leavening agent that releases carbon dioxide when it comes into contact with an acidic ingredient, such as buttermilk or lemon juice, and heat. In contrast, baking powder already contains both an acid and a base, and when activated by heat, it releases carbon dioxide, causing the batter or dough to rise. If baking soda is used in place of baking powder, the acid in the recipe may not be enough to activate the soda, resulting in the batter not rising adequately during baking. As a result, the final product may be flat and lack the desired texture and volume. It is always important to carefully read and follow a recipe’s ingredient list and instructions to ensure the best possible outcome.

Can I use baking soda instead of baking powder for pancakes?

Baking soda and baking powder are both leavening agents commonly used in baking, but they serve different purposes. While baking powder is a complete leavening agent that contains both an acid and a base, baking soda is a base that needs an acid present in the batter to activate its leavening properties. As a result, using baking soda as a substitute for baking powder in a pancake recipe may not yield the desired results. Baking soda will create a quick rise when the batter is first poured onto the griddle, but the pancakes may collapse as they cook due to a lack of sustained leavening. To achieve the proper texture and consistency, it’s best to use baking powder in pancake recipes, or for baking soda substitutions, consider adding an acid like lemon juice, vinegar, or cream of tartar to activate its leavening properties.
